人妻系列无码专区av在线,国内精品久久久久久婷婷,久草视频在线播放,精品国产线拍大陆久久尤物

當(dāng)前位置:首頁 > 開發(fā)語言 > 正文

c語言define定義怎么用?完整語法、用法及舉例說明

c語言define定義怎么用?完整語法、用法及舉例說明

C語言中的#define是,有什么作用,怎樣用?? 1、d是C語言中的格式控制符,用于輸出整型變量的十進(jìn)制形式。這個符號告訴printf函數(shù),接下來的數(shù)據(jù)應(yīng)該以整型的形...

C語言中的#define是,有什么作用,怎樣用??

1、d是C語言中的格式控制符,用于輸出整型變量的十進(jìn)制形式。這個符號告訴printf函數(shù),接下來的數(shù)據(jù)應(yīng)該以整型的形式輸出。例如,int a = 10; 這行代碼定義了一個整型變量a,并將其值設(shè)置為10。在printf函數(shù)中,\n是一個轉(zhuǎn)義序列,用于表示換行。

2、c語言中的“!”是邏輯運算中的非運算?!?!”是C語言中的非運算符,在變量前面使用它,會構(gòu)建非運算表達(dá)式,表達(dá)式的返回結(jié)果是個布爾值(也就是只有true或fal)。對變量使用時,如果變量不是布爾數(shù)據(jù)類型,將會轉(zhuǎn)化為布爾類型再使用,如整形變量123將被轉(zhuǎn)化為true,整形變量0將被轉(zhuǎn)化為fal。

3、C語言中,算術(shù)運算符“%”代表模(取余)運算,“++”代表變量自增運算,“--”代表變量自減運算。模運算“%”“?!笔恰癕od”的音譯,模運算多應(yīng)用于程序編寫中。 Mod的含義為求余。

4、C語言中的% 2d是printf()函數(shù)的輸出格式中的%a.bf。表示將數(shù)字按寬度為2,采用右對齊方式輸出,若數(shù)據(jù)位數(shù)不到2位,則左邊補(bǔ)空格。如:“%8d ”要求輸出寬度為8,而a值為15只有兩位故補(bǔ)三個空格。

5、是C語言中的格式字符,c代表了輸出字符類型,3代表了占位情況,%3c的意思是輸出一個占位3的字符。式樣化規(guī)定字符, 以%開端, 后跟一個或幾個規(guī)定字符, 用來確定輸出內(nèi)容式樣。

c語言中define是

1、define在c語言中是一個宏定義的關(guān)鍵字,有定義、解釋的意思。在C語言中的用法是“#define 變量名 值”,這句代碼是使用在程序開頭的,這樣整個程序中對應(yīng)的變量名就會在預(yù)編譯的時候用后面的值替換。define在c語言中的作用就是方便程序段的定義和修改,可以將一個變量定義為你想要的值。

2、define 是C語言中的預(yù)處理器指令,用于定義宏。它在編譯之前將代碼中的特定文本替換為預(yù)定義的文本。例如,可以定義一個常量,如:#define PI 14159,之后在程序中直接使用 PI 即可。使用 #define 定義常量的好處是,如果后續(xù)需要更改該常量的值,只需更改定義即可,而不需要在程序中多個地方修改。

3、C語言中define的含義是定義宏。詳細(xì)解釋如下:定義宏的基本概念 在C語言中,`define`是預(yù)處理器的一個指令,用于定義宏。預(yù)處理器是編譯器的預(yù)處理階段,它會處理源代碼中的指令,包括宏定義等。通過`define`,我們可以定義代碼中的常量、替換文本或者條件編譯指令等。

4、C語言中define的含義是定義宏。詳細(xì)解釋如下:定義宏的基本概念 在C語言中,`define`是一個預(yù)處理指令,主要用于定義宏。宏是一種在編譯時由預(yù)處理器處理的代碼片段或值替換的規(guī)則。當(dāng)你在代碼中使用一個被定義的宏時,預(yù)處理器會在編譯前替換這些宏,使得代碼更加簡潔和易于理解。